About Alternative

Born from the rebellion against mainstream pop, this genre thrives on sonic experimentation and raw lyricism. Audiences attending these live performances can expect anything from distorted guitars and driving basslines to quirky synthesizer melodies and intimate, stripped-back acoustic sets. The atmosphere is typically highly charged, filled with dedicated fans who value artistic independence over polished commercialism. The settings for these shows vary wildly, ranging from sweaty, low-ceilinged basement clubs to vast outdoor festival fields. Smaller rooms offer an intense, communal energy where the sweat and volume are felt up close, while larger spaces accommodate elaborate light shows and cavernous acoustics.
